Details
This exceptionally versatile four-bedroom terraced house offers a substantial 1,869 sq ft of flexible accommodation, making it an outstanding opportunity for a wide range of buyers. The property is currently arranged to include a spacious shop/commercial area to the front, perfectly suited for business use or conversion to additional living space (subject to the necessary consents). The ground floor also features generous living accommodation, with well-proportioned rooms that provide ample space for relaxation and entertaining. A bright conservatory to the rear adds further flexibility, creating an ideal spot for dining, a playroom, or a home office. Upstairs, you will find four good-sized bedrooms, all serviced by a well-appointed family bathroom. This layout is ideal for families, professionals, or investors seeking a House in Multiple Occupation (HMO) setup. The property’s prime position near one of the area’s most popular schools enhances its appeal to families, while proximity to Whiston Hospital makes it highly attractive for healthcare professionals or those seeking strong rental demand. With excellent road links and easy access to surrounding towns, motorway networks, and local amenities, this property offers both convenience and potential for a variety of uses.
The outside space further elevates this property, featuring a generous wraparound garden to the side and rear. This outdoor area provides plenty of space for children to play, for entertaining guests, or for relaxing in a private setting. The garden also offers direct access to a detached garage, which is ideal for secure parking, workshop use, or additional storage. There is further potential for commercial or business-related activities, given the separate access and layout. Additional storage areas are available, ensuring practical solutions for families or business owners with extra requirements. Mature planting and fencing create a sense of privacy, while the garden’s layout allows for easy maintenance and a variety of uses.
